Publisher's Synopsis

Animal Training 101 offers a marriage of the science of animal behavior and the art of animal training. This approach is presented in a simple, practical way for both the professional and the beginning enthusiast working with any species. Animal Training 101 thoroughly explains the entire spectrum of training methods. Dr. Jenifer Zeligs provides a cost-benefit analysis of each approach, while focusing on a trusting, positive relationship between animal and trainer. This well-organized reference enables you to easily find the optimal techniques to solve your specific challenges and decide which techniques suit your individual needs. Animal Training 101 features: - Practical information useful to train both domestic and exotic animals - Beginning and advanced techniques - The most comprehensive and modern glossary of terms available - Color illustrations
